- ❄️ Winter weather events, including snow, ice, and cold temperatures, are having significant economic impacts across the South Central, Southeast, Northeast, and Midwest.
- 💡 This is a large consumer-impacting event, affecting purchasing decisions and demand for various goods.
Consumer Purchasing Behavior
- 🛒 Consumers are already engaging in need-based purchasing to prepare for being indoors for extended periods, driving up sales of items like ice melt, heaters, and boots.
- 📈 Sales of essential items such as eggs, milk, chili, and canned goods also see a significant increase as people stock up.
- ⚠️ Consumers may experience decision paralysis when deciding when to shop, fearing stockouts or crowds.
Retailer Preparedness and Supply Chain
- 📦 Retailers have been planning for these events due to clear forecasting, ensuring goods are available on shelves to meet demand.
- 📉 While some businesses see a lift in advance of the storm, most will experience a precipitative drop in traffic during the event.
- 🛍️ Post-storm, there will be a return of consumers to replenish supplies or purchase items they couldn't get beforehand.
Potential for Power Outages
- ⚡ Widespread ice, particularly in the South, has the potential to cause several hundred thousand or more power outages.
- 🥶 The prolonged cold following ice events means there won't be an immediate opportunity for melting, compounding the impact and potentially leading to significant costs.
- 🛠️ Obtaining last-minute generators can be difficult, with larger whole-house solutions being impractical on short notice.
